Why These Are the Top Bathroom Remodeling Contractors in Mazon

The bathroom remodeling market for Mazon, Illinois, and the broader Grundy County area is characterized by a modest number of local and regional contractors rather than a high volume of large-scale companies. Due to Mazon's small size, residents typically rely on contractors from nearby hubs like Morris, Seneca, and Ottawa. The competition is moderate, which generally keeps pricing competitive but not as low as in highly saturated urban markets. The average quality of work is high among the established providers, who rely heavily on local reputation and word-of-mouth referrals. Typical pricing for a full bathroom remodel in this region can range from $10,000 for a basic update to $25,000+ for a high-end, custom renovation with layout changes and accessibility features. Homeowners are advised to verify licensing and insurance directly and obtain multiple detailed quotes for their projects.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bathroom Remodeling in Mazon

Get answers to common questions about bathroom remodeling services in Mazon, Illinois.

1What is the typical cost range for a full bathroom remodel in Mazon, Illinois?

For a standard full bathroom remodel in Mazon, homeowners can typically expect a cost range between $15,000 and $35,000, with the final price heavily dependent on material selections, layout changes, and fixture quality. Regional pricing in Grundy County is generally more affordable than the Chicago metro area, but labor and material costs have risen. A straightforward cosmetic update may fall on the lower end, while a full gut job with high-end finishes, custom cabinetry, and moving plumbing will reach the higher end of the spectrum.

2How does the Illinois climate and Mazon's seasonal weather affect remodeling timing?

Mazon experiences all four seasons, with cold, damp winters and humid summers, which are crucial planning factors. The ideal times for remodeling are late spring through early fall, as this allows for proper ventilation during painting or sealing and avoids potential delays from winter weather for contractors traveling from nearby areas. Furthermore, our climate's humidity swings make it essential to choose moisture-resistant materials like porcelain tile and proper exhaust ventilation to prevent mold and material warping over time.

3Do I need a permit for a bathroom remodel in Mazon, and what local regulations should I know?

Yes, permits are often required for structural, electrical, and plumbing work in Mazon, and your contractor should handle this process with the Village of Mazon or Grundy County. Key local regulations adhere to the Illinois Plumbing Code and National Electrical Code, with specific attention to GFCI outlet placement near water sources and proper venting for drains. Always verify your contractor is licensed and insured in Illinois, as this ensures they understand and comply with these necessary standards.

4What should I look for when choosing a bathroom remodeling contractor in the Mazon area?

Prioritize local contractors with verifiable references and a physical presence in Grundy or neighboring counties, as they understand regional supply chains and logistics. Check their Illinois license status, insurance, and portfolio of completed projects similar to your vision. It's also wise to choose a provider familiar with older homes common in Mazon, as they can adeptly handle unexpected issues like outdated plumbing or structural adjustments that may arise during demolition.

5What are common structural or plumbing concerns in Mazon homes during a remodel?

Many homes in Mazon have older foundations and plumbing systems, so it's common to discover cast iron drains, galvanized supply lines, or insufficient subflooring during a tear-out. A reputable local contractor will plan for these contingencies, recommending upgrades to modern PEX piping and ensuring the floor structure can support heavy materials like a cast iron or stone tile. Addressing these proactively prevents future leaks and structural issues, ensuring a durable remodel suited to our local conditions.
